About the Opportunity
The opportunity will involve managing a portfolio of strata claims (end-to-end) and will require strong stakeholder engagement; you will be comfortable in picking up the phone and providing updates and outcomes to your key stakeholders, in relation to their claims.
Whilst we would prefer someone with insurance/strata claims management experience, we are open to hearing from you if you do not have a strata claims or insurance background; essentially, we are looking for customer service/retail/call-centre superstars who are open to learning the fundamentals of insurance (on the job) and have the mindset of building a career in insurance.
Please note that the internal position title is Strata Internal Claims Adjuster, however similar or related job titles could be Claims Consultant, Claims Manager, Claims Handler, Claims Assessor.

Key Responsibilities
- Manage a portfolio of strata claims
- Providing support and advice to policyholders during the claims process
- Examine claim forms, policies and endorsements, client instructions and other records to determine coverage
- Investigate claims by conducting office-based analysis of physical damage details, interviewing claimants and comparing claim information with evidence
- Set loss reserves and update when changes in circumstances become apparent
- Prepare reports by collecting and summarising information required
- Settle claims after determining the insurance carrier's liability
About Crawford
Crawford is the world's largest publicly listed claims management company operating in more than 70 countries. Crawford has been in operation for over 80 years and is committed to restoring and enhancing lives, businesses, and communities affected by natural disasters and catastrophic events.
Crawford is the only provider in Australia to offer services across the entire claim lifecycle – from 'first notification of loss' through to litigation:
- Loss adjusting – property, major and complex loss, catastrophe response
- Third party administration (Crawford TPA is a Lloyd's accredited provider)
- Forensic accounting including business interruption expertise
- Cyber response
- Managed repair services (Contractor Connection)
- Quantity surveying, forensic engineering & building consultancy (CRD Building Consultants)
